Mesut Ozil has been backed to bounce back at Arsenal under Unai Emery despite how bleak the circumstances might look right now.

The German midfielder has fallen out of favour at Arsenal ever since Emery took over and his selection has been reduced to mere 2 games this season. However, former Turkish international, Hamit Altintop still has hope that Ozil could rediscover her form.

Speaking during an interview with Goal, the former Schalke, Bayern Munich and Real Madrid midfielder said, “Mesut is a good guy who has had an unbelievable career.

“He is always respectful and serious and that’s the base for a good sportsman. He’s a young man and he’s allowed to make mistakes. That’s important. His current situation at Arsenal is not good but this is part of life and his career. He worked hard for 10 years for his passion so I think he will come back.”

While his peers might still have hope for him, Arsenal seems to have given up on Ozil. Reports are constantly emerging about the Gunners looking for vendors to loan him out to.

Sources claim Fenerbahce made an offer and Arsenal agreed to pay a part of Ozil’s wages just to conclude the deal.
